The Role of Alloy Metals in 925 Sterling Silver Belcher Chains

925 sterling silver represents a masterclass in metallurgical engineering. While pure silver offers unparalleled brilliance, it lacks the structural rigidity required for the complex interlocking links of a Belcher chain. By integrating precisely 7.5% alloy metals, we transform a delicate precious metal into a high-performance material capable of enduring the mechanical stresses of daily wear.

7-Table Framework for Sterling Silver Metallurgy

1. Composition & Purity Standards

Metal Type Silver Content % Alloy Content % Vickers Hardness (Hv) Specific Gravity (g/cm³)
Fine Silver (999)99.9%0.1%25 – 35 Hv10.49 g/cm³
Sterling Silver (925)92.5%7.5%75 – 100 Hv10.36 g/cm³
Argentium Silver93.5%6.5%100 – 120 Hv10.30 g/cm³
Table 1 Analysis: The integration of 7.5% alloy (typically copper) into pure silver results in a three-fold increase in Vickers Hardness (Hv). While 999 fine silver is chemically "purer," its low Hv rating makes it unsuitable for the tensile strain placed on a Belcher chain's links. At H.E. Phillips Ltd, we ensure that every 925 hallmark represents this specific metallurgical balance, providing the necessary resistance to deformation. The specific gravity remains relatively consistent, ensuring the luxurious "heavy" feel that Devon collectors expect from authentic precious metals.

2. Common Alloy Elements & Function

Alloy ElementPrimary FunctionImpact on FinishAllergy Profile
CopperStructural StrengtheningMinimal (High Lustre)Hypoallergenic
ZincDeoxidiser/CastabilityBrightens SurfaceLow Risk
GermaniumTarnish ResistanceSuperior BrightnessSafe
NickelWhitening/HardeningCorrosive potentialHigh Allergen (Avoided)
Table 2 Analysis: Copper remains the primary alloying agent due to its compatibility with silver's molecular structure. Unlike nickel, which is a significant allergen and regulated under UK law, copper provides mechanical strength without compromising skin safety. 3. Belcher Link Mechanical Integrity

Link AttributePure Silver (999)Sterling Silver (925)Audit Protocol
Tensile StrengthLow (Prone to snap)High (Elastic limit)Load Stress Test
Abrasion ResistanceVery LowModerate-HighSurface Scratch Check
Form RetentionPoor (Links flatten)ExcellentCaliper Symmetry Check
Table 3 Analysis: Belcher chains rely on the uniform circularity of their interlocking links. Under stress, fine silver links will "neck" and eventually shear. The alloyed structure of 925 sterling silver provides a much higher elastic limit, meaning the links return to their original shape after minor tension. Since August 2000, our H.E. Metallurgy & Composition

1. What is the exact purpose of the 7.5% alloy?

The primary purpose is to increase the Vickers Hardness (Hv) of the metal. Pure silver is too soft to maintain the intricate shape of a Belcher chain link under tension. The alloy (usually copper) creates a stronger molecular lattice that resists bending, scratching, and snapping. This makes the chain a practical "wearable asset" rather than a fragile ornament. Maintenance & Environmental Care

5. Why does my sterling silver chain turn black?

This is called tarnishing, a chemical reaction between the silver (and its copper alloy) and sulphur in the air. It creates a thin layer of silver sulphide. It is not a sign of poor quality; in fact, it proves the metal is genuine silver. Regular polishing with a soft cloth removes this layer easily. Residents near the River Dart may notice faster tarnishing due to higher humidity and atmospheric sulphur.

6. How should I store my silver chain in Devon?

The maritime air in Totnes is humid. To prevent oxidation, store your chain in an airtight pouch or a lined jewellery box. Placing a small anti-tarnish strip in the box can also absorb harmful gases. Durability & Physics

9. Which is stronger: a Belcher or a Curb chain?

Both are highly durable due to their interlocking nature. However, a Belcher chain's round or oval links provide a more uniform distribution of stress. If the alloy is high-quality 925, both styles will last a lifetime. The Belcher is often preferred for carrying heavy pendants because its links are less likely to "twist" under weight. 10. Can a broken sterling silver chain be repaired?

Yes. Because of the strength provided by the alloy, sterling silver is excellent for soldering. Our on-site workshop in Totnes can repair broken links or replace damaged clasps. Unlike "silver-plated" items, which cannot be soldered without destroying the finish, solid 925 sterling silver is fully restorable. Authentication & Trust

13. What should I look for in a UK hallmark?

A standard UK hallmark for silver includes three marks: the Maker's Mark (responsibility mark), the Standard Mark (925 for sterling), and the Assay Office Mark (e.g., an Anchor for Birmingham). This is your legal guarantee of purity. At our Fore Street shop, we provide a loupe so you can inspect these marks. We never sell unverified or "mystery alloy" silver.
